Bengali Fish Curry

Bengali Fish Curry

Bengali fish is a dish a fish lover should not miss! This recipe of Bengali fish is a perfect blend of flavors; fish fillets are cooked in a marinade of lemon juice, turmeric paste, garlic, coriander, and mustard, leaving you craving for more.

Ingredients

lemon Juice: 1 tbsp

oil: 2 tbsp

salt to taste

fillets—washed and sliced: 6 fish

red chilli: 1 tbsp

mustard powder: 1 tsp

turmeric paste: 1 tsp

green chilis: 4

Chopped coriander leaves: 1 tbsp

Garlic powder: 1 tbsp

leaf: 1 bay

small onions--chopped: 4

ginger: 1 tbsp

How To Make Bengali Fish Curry

  1. Marinate fish with salt, turmeric paste, and lemon juice and let sit for 20 minutes.
  2. In a pan over medium heat, drizzle some oil and splutter mustard. Once the popping sounds dwindle, add bay leaf, onion, chilies, garlic and ginger and saute for a minute.
  3. Add marinated fish fillets and fry for a few minutes, turn the fillets over and fry until the fish is evenly cooked through.
  4. Turn off the heat, garnish with coriander leaves and serve with rice or flatbreads.
